Back to Previous Page

Tri-n-butyltin hydride, 97%, 50 g

ITEM#: 3136-A1329818

MFR#: A13298-18

Tri-n-butyltin hydride, 97%, 50 g

Tri-n-butyltin hydride, 97%, 50 g